Sanjana Kashinath, MD is an Assistant Professor in the Department of Hematology Oncology at Fox Chase Cancer Center. She specializes in classical hematology and sees patients at Temple University Hospital – Main Campus.

Dr. Kashinath believes the best care begins with partnership, compassion, and open communication. She is committed to helping patients understand their diagnosis—or, when a diagnosis is still being established, the steps being taken to reach one. By taking the time to explain each stage of the process, she empowers patients to make informed decisions and feel confident in their care.

She works closely with colleagues and specialists to develop individualized treatment plans that reflect the latest advances in hematology. Her goal is to ensure that every patient feels supported throughout their healthcare journey, providing honest guidance, thoughtful care, and a trusted partnership from diagnosis through treatment.

In addition to her clinical practice, Dr. Kashinath is involved in research focused on improving care for patients with blood disorders. Her work includes studies evaluating safer and more effective anticoagulation strategies, as well as clinical trials investigating new treatment options for patients with immune thrombocytopenia (ITP) and diffuse large B-cell lymphoma (DLBCL).
